Summary: Coupled first-order IVPs are frequently used in many parts of engineering and sciences. We present a ``solver'' including three computer programs which were joint with the MATLAB software to solve and plot solutions of the first-order coupled stiff or nonstiff IVPs. Some applications related to IVPs are given here using our MATLAB-linked solver. Muon catalyzed fusion in a \(D-T\) mixture is considered as a first dynamical example of the coupled IVPs. Then, we have focused on the fuel depletion in a suggested PWR including poisons burnups (Xenon-135 and Samarium-149), Plutonium isotopes production, and Uranium depletion.
